Output 43848136d15c654a22b31ed07f2a6eb9fd8a5d69acac1a6b90bb1740a0efd7e8:6

value
2384300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7d50ff49b35e8d2d778fa7cdee27b410c9f30e1 OP_EQUAL
address
3KuddYjaYddbRAhwZejGidni4q8v6GiQbG
transaction
43848136d15c654a22b31ed07f2a6eb9fd8a5d69acac1a6b90bb1740a0efd7e8
spent
true